Bahasa Melayu
jebak
English
continuous heavy flow
Used for a heavy, continuous flow of water or blood.
جيبق
Examples
Contoh ayat
Air sungai itu berjebak selepas hujan lebat.
The river water flowed heavily after the heavy rain.
Lukanya berjebak dan perlu segera dibersihkan.
The wound was bleeding heavily and needed to be cleaned quickly.
